Jewelry for ChildrenEarrings for Children
Purchasing earrings for a child can be difficult. For safety reasons, I’ve always been concerned when I see small children or babies wearing dangling earrings or ones with large hoops. As a mother, I know that kids aren’t always careful and accidents do happen where earrings can be pulled or torn from the earlobe. I feel much better when parents stick to simple stud earrings or ones with small designs that fit closely to the ear of their small child. As a second safety concern, parents should select earrings with either gold or surgical steel posts to prevent infections. Lastly, the jewelry should have clasps that secure tightly so that they don’t become loose and hence, a choking danger. The older the child, the more capable that child is of wearing a larger variety of earrings.
